Swahili

Etymology

Borrowed from Arabic مُشَاهَرَة (mušāhara, monthly salary).

Pronunciation

  • Audio (Kenya):(file)

Noun

mshahara class III (plural mishahara class IV)

  1. salary, wage (fixed amount of money paid on monthly or annual basis)
